Navigating Legal Proceedings After an Arrest

Facing legal proceedings following an arrest can be a daunting experience. It's crucial to understand your rights and the steps involved to protect yourself throughout the process. Creating a checklist can help you stay organized and navigate this challenging time effectively.

Initially, it's essential to consult an experienced criminal defense attorney as soon as possible. They can guide you through your legal options, clarify the charges against you, and represent your interests in court.

Next, make sure to maintain all evidence related to your case, including any documentation. It's also important to refrain from making any comments to law enforcement or anyone else without first discussing your attorney.

  • Keep in mind that you have the right to remain silent and request legal counsel.
  • Participate in all court hearings and obey your attorney's advice.
  • Gather necessary documents and evidence for trial.

By adhering to these steps, you can increase your chances of a favorable outcome in your legal proceedings.
